To promote motor output by adopting a structure, capable of conducting a coil winding with the sufficient number of windings to an armature confronting with a field magnet, even when magnetic collecting sections are provided to the front ends of core salient poles.
In an armature 5 of a linear motor, magnetic collecting yoke plates 55 and 56 are mounted to the front ends of a pair of salient poles 52 and 53, projected vertically from a core 51 by means of welding, etc. Those magnetic collecting yoke plates 55 and 56 are mounted after a coils winding 54 is wound on the core 51 and do not interrupt yoke plates 55, 56 in the case the coil winding 54 is wound thereon. Accordingly, the coil winding 54 can be wound equally with the sufficient number of windings.
